The Two Row Wampum belt (pictured on the button) is the symbolic record of the first agreement between Europeans and an Indigenous Nation on Turtle Island/North America. Usually dated to 1613, this treaty is the foundation on which all subsequent treaty relationships were made by the Haudenosaunee and other Native Nations with settler governments on this continent. 

The agreement outlines a mutual, three-part commitment to friendship, peace between peoples, and living in parallel forever (as long as the grass is green, as long as the rivers flow downhill and as long as the sun rises in the east and sets in the west). Throughout the years, the Haudenosaunee have sought to honor this mutual vision and have increasingly emphasized that ecological stewardship is a fundamental prerequisite for this continuing friendship.
